HR Strategies: Responsibilities of an HR Consultant

As an HR consultancy, you’ll be the architect of a company’s human capital success. Think of it as a symphony where you play a pivotal role, harmonizing policies, practices, and people to drive organizational success. Your responsibilities will encompass:

  1. Strategic Architect: Design and implement custom HR strategies, programs, and projects tailored to each client’s unique needs and aspirations.
  2. Policy Powerhouse: Guide and advise on HR policies, ensuring compliance and best practices while reflecting the company’s specific culture and values.
  3. Data Detective: Conduct research through surveys, data analysis, and interviews to gain deep insights and inform strategic decisions.
  4. Implementation Champion: Spearhead the rollout of new HR initiatives, ensuring smooth transitions and seamless adoption by teams.
  5. Change Catalyst: Drive positive change and cultivate a vibrant workplace culture through innovative plans and engaging techniques.
  6. Problem-Solver Extraordinaire: Provide expert advice and solutions to resolve complex HR issues, empowering managers and teams to thrive.
  7. Talent Maestro: Craft effective recruitment strategies, facilitate impactful training programs, and contribute to optimal employee management.
  8. Continuous Improvement Advocate: Stay abreast of evolving HR trends and technologies, identifying and implementing opportunities for ongoing optimization.

FAQs

What are the different types of HR Consultants?

There are general HR Consultants who offer a broad range of knowledge and specialist consultants who focus on specific areas like legal compliance, recruitment, or compensation. Choosing the right type depends on your company’s unique needs and challenges.

How can I find the right HR Consultant for my business?

Ask for recommendations from other businesses, research consultants online, and interview potential candidates to find someone who understands your company culture and can address your specific needs.

What are the benefits of working with an HR Consultant?

Some key benefits include:

  • Access to expert HR knowledge and experience
  • Reduced risk of compliance issues
  • Improved employee engagement and retention
  • Increased efficiency and productivity
  • Scalable support to meet changing needs
  • Access to innovative HR technology and solutions

What types of businesses benefit most from working with an HR Consultant?

All kinds of businesses can benefit from HR Consultant expertise, from startups building their HR foundation to established companies facing complex challenges. Consultants can tailor their services to specific needs, whether it’s recruitment, talent development, compliance, or workplace culture.
